Quip Corporation wants to purchase a new machine for $300,000. Management predicts that the machine will produce sales of $200,000 each year for the next 5 years. Expenses are expected to include direct materials, direct labor, and factory overhead (excluding depreciation) totaling $80,000 per year. The firm uses straight-line depreciation with an assumed residual (salvage) value of $50,000. Quip's combined income tax rate, t, is 40%.
Management requires a minimum after-tax rate of return of 10% on all investments. What is the estimated net present value (NPV) of the proposed investment (rounded to the nearest hundred dollars) ? (The PV annuity factor for 10%, 5 years, is 3.791 and for 4 years it is 3.17. The present value $1 factor for 10%, 5 years, is 0.621.) Assume that after-tax cash inflows occur at year-end.
A) $48,800.
B) $79,800.
C) $99,000.
D) $112,000.
E) $70,000.
